About us:

Clearwave Fiber, a 100% Fiber Optic Internet provider offering business, enterprise, and residential communications services, is expanding its network to reach new communities across the Midwest and Southeast regions. This new venture was formed from Hargray Fiber and Clearwave Communications. Clearwave Fiber has the financial backing of Cable One, GTCR, Stephens Capital, and The Pritzker Organization. Our Team of more than 400 colleagues is committed to delivering the most advanced technology and customer service. General Description of Position: Acts in a confidential capacity to provide administrative services such as records control, creating special reports and studies, keeping and facilitating records and maintaining schedules incidental to the overall efficient sales operation.

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Manages the day-to-day operations of the department
  • Fields phone calls, answers questions and directs calls to appropriate colleagues
  • Responds to and corrects order rejects that come back to sales
  • Reviews sales orders prior to order submission to ensure for accuracy
  • Organizes and maintains files and records
  • Coordinates collection and preparation of various materials as requested
  • Plans and schedules meetings and appointments
  • Makes travel, meeting and event arrangements
  • Maintain filing system for Company documents and ensure their confidentiality
  • Manages projects and conducts research
  • Prepares and edits correspondence, reports, and presentations
  • Responsible for filing and data entry
  • Places orders for supplies and services
  • Coordinates meals, when needed
  • Provides quality customer service
  • Performs other duties as assigned


Requirements

Minimum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• 2+ years of experience in administrative support role
  • Strong computer and Internet research skills
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, Word and Power Point
  • Knowledge of SalesForce an extra
  • Flexibility
  • Excellent interpersonal skills
  • Project coordination experience
  • Ability to work well with all levels of internal management and staff, outside clients and vendors
  • Sensitivity to confidential matters may be required
